Job summary

Gushengtang TCM Pte Ltd is seeking an experienced HR Business Partner to lead overseas HR strategy across Malaysia and Singapore. You will align Group HQ HR policies with local realities, drive international staffing plans, and support expansion through M&A and joint ventures.

The role requires 5+ years in HR, including cross-border experience, fluency in English and Chinese, and strong capabilities in recruitment, talent development, and regulatory compliance for overseas operations.

Job description

Develop an in-depth understanding of the strategic objectives and operational rhythms of overseas businesses (Malaysia, Singapore.), and act as the core HR advisor to business leaders, participating in overseas business strategic planning and organizational design. Take on HR requirements from overseas operations, integrating Group HQ's human resources strategy with local business realities to formulate annual HR plans tailored to overseas markets. Support the multi-model overseas expansion of self-built, partnership, and M&A, providing organizational structure, headcount and staffing plans, and labor budget proposals for store expansion and joint venture establishment.

Key responsibilities

Lead the recruitment of core talent in overseas markets, build localized recruitment channels, and establish overseas talent pools and talent maps

Collaborate with the Group's talent development system, support the co-development of talent training programs with local colleges and universities, and promote two-way exchange of TCM physicians and the building of local talent pipelines

Participate in due diligence (HR dimension) for overseas M&A and joint venture projects, assessing the target institutions' workforce structure, compensation and benefits, labor relations, and compliance risks

Lead post-merger integration (PMI) on the HR front, designing plans for organizational integration, key talent retention, compensation system alignment, and cultural fusion to ensure smooth business transition

Research and track labor laws, employment policies, and visa and work permit requirements in Malaysia, Singapore, and other locations to ensure compliant employment practices

Develop and continuously optimize employee handbooks, compensation and benefits policies, and attendance and leave systems for overseas markets in light of local regulations and cultural differences

Assist with visas, work permits, tax and social security arrangements for expatriates, as well as cross-cultural adaptation support

Localize the Group's performance management system, designing performance appraisal schemes and incentive mechanisms suited to overseas markets

Conduct compensation surveys and benchmarking for overseas markets, establishing competitive pay structures that balance Group-wide consistency with local differences

Foster cross-cultural integration and collaboration between Chinese and local employees, organize cultural advocacy and team-building activities, and cultivate an open and inclusive organizational climate

About you

Bachelor's degree or above, preferably in Human Resources Management, Business Administration, Psychology, or related fields

5+ years of HR experience, including 3+ years as an HRBP or in a business support role, with hands-on experience across the full recruitment-performance-employee relations cycle

Experience in overseas/cross-border HR management; familiarity with labor laws and employment practices in Singapore or Southeast Asian markets is preferred

Fluent in both Chinese and English, capable of business communication and document drafting in both languages

Business acumen and organizational sensitivity, with the ability to closely align HR strategies with business objectives

Outstanding cross-cultural communication and influence, able to build trust and drive change in multicultural environments

Experience in post-merger HR integration (PMI) or building an HR system from 0 to 1 for a joint venture is a plus

Results-oriented, resilient under pressure, and adaptable to frequent overseas travel and a fast-paced expansion environment

HRBP experience in the healthcare or multi-site chain service industry is preferred

Familiarity with the TCM (Traditional Chinese Medicine) industry ecosystem, or an affinity for TCM culture is preferred
